Hold On Partner
Recorded by Roy Rogers (King of the Cowboys) and Clint Black
Written by Bobby Paine and Larson Paine
 
A 1991 chart hit, #42 USA and #48 in CAN, for Roy and Clint.  This
put Roy 'back' in the saddle (recording wise) one more time before
he sadly passed away a few years later.
 
Born:  November 5, 1911 ? Died:  July 6, 1998
 
He was a genuinely 'nice' man, and a true hero/star to MILLIONS.
He was a prolific singer and actor for many decades, besides all of his
charity work and working for adoption centers.  He talked the talk, and
walked the walk.
 
*He truly was the silver screen's, 'King of the Cowboys!'*
